Course: SCI 590. Professional Development to Transform STEM Teaching (3)
Prerequisite: Instructor consent. Directed activities to prepare current and future university-level STEM instructors to increase student engagement and active learning at the post-secondary level. Pedagogical activities focus on current research on student learning, teaching routines, talking as a means to learning, classroom discussion, and student motivation. The class culminates with a structured peer-observation protocol to observe recordings of two teaching examples for each participant. Participants enrolled in this course should have teaching opportunities with students over the course of the semester.
